Originally posted by z00t
Instead of a skull I get that in the two games i have with Improv that are 3 or 4 moves deep. Why doesn't the skull appear? Those two slots are taking up valuable space I could be playing.
They have an opportunity to appeal as I understand it.

When this last happened to me it was about 14 days before the games were auto resigned.

So your options are
(1) wait 14 days;
(2) resign the games and take on 2 more; or
(3) subscribe and play as many as you want.
